Accent Privacy Lever Lockset

The Schlage Accent privacy lever brings dependable Grade 2 security and classic styling to bedroom and bathroom doors. Designed for 1-3/8 to 1-3/4 in. thick doors with a universal latch, it installs quickly with just a screwdriver and provides push-button privacy locking.


Key Features:

  • Grade 2 Security: ANSI/BHMA certified for durability and performance
  • Privacy Function: Push-button locks from the inside and unlocks with emergency pin from outside
  • Easy Installation: Self-aligning screw holes and universal latch fit 2-3/8 in. or 2-3/4 in. backsets
  • Flexible Door Fit: Works with 1-3/8 in. to 1-3/4 in. thick, right or left-handed doors
  • Lasting Quality: Premium metal construction with limited lifetime mechanical and finish warranty

Specifications Table:

Specification Details
Function Privacy (bed & bath)
ANSI/BHMA Grade A156.2 2011 Grade 2; A156.39-2015 Grade AAA in Security, Durability and Finish
Backset Universal; fits 2-3/8 in. or 2-3/4 in. backsets
Door Thickness 1-3/8 in. to 1-3/4 in. (35mm–44mm)
Handing Universal (right or left)
ADA Compliant Yes
UL Listed Locks for up to three-hour fire doors available
Applications Residential single- and multi-family doors
Warranty Limited Lifetime Mechanical and Finish Warranty
Material Premium metal construction
Finish Options Multiple finishes available including Bright Brass, Satin Nickel, Matte Black and more
Emergency Release Pin key from exterior
Installation Self-aligning screw holes; installs with a screwdriver

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):

Q: What doors is this privacy lever intended for?
A: It’s ideal for bedroom and bathroom doors where locking is desired.


Q: Will it fit my existing door prep?
A: Yes, the universal latch fits 2-3/8 in. or 2-3/4 in. backsets and door thickness from 1-3/8 in. to 1-3/4 in.


Q: How do you unlock it in an emergency?
A: Use the included pin key from the outside; it also unlocks automatically when the inside lever is turned.


Q: Is it ADA compliant?
A: Yes, the lever design is ADA compliant.


Q: What warranty is included?
A: It’s backed by a limited lifetime mechanical and finish warranty.
